The air of something beyond the mundane hangs in the ether. The tang of the unusual whets your lips. Bree is unaccustomed to these sorts of changes. You are a simple folk, with simple desires. You want to work, spend time relaxing with friends and family, and have a respectable life. You are farmers, millers, weavers, and other businesspeople. You are hobbits and man and the occasional dwarf.
When the Black Riders rode through the village, darkness followed in their wake. The taint of dark has not left the Bree since. Some of you have led the charge to do something about this. You are not an easily roused folk, but now is not the time for the sedentary. If there has ever been a call to action in the history of your town, it is now. It only took a week before various town leaders had roused the populace. However, you need to look within the town, not without. Breefolk are hardened and ready to attack outside forces, but this is a rot from within. No people living in the shadow of the Barrow Downs would be accused of being weak. Hardiness is a way of life. However, now a different fortitude is required. You know that the Black Riders had help from within these very walls. Now it is time to do something about it. All twenty-five of the various suspects about Bree are brought together, including various town leaders, people who had contact with Mr. Underhill and Strider, people who may have been in the area, and strangers that have recently made Bree their home. You must decide for yourselves when and to whom you will administer justice. This may require quick wits, intuition, and a strong stomach. As of right now, the game has begun. Lynch votes may begin, and you may discuss the game. Day One will end Monday Night at 10:00 pm EST. -Anxiety |

For those who never read the stories, or saw the movies there is a character named Smeagol who suffered from Dissociative identity disorder who had a second personality named Gollum. His disorder came about due to a traumatic experience as a younger hobbit where he killed his relative and best friend over a ring that "called to him".
I've been curious about Blade playing out a Dissociative identity disorder type personality so far this game since Gollum by no means was helpful or friendly in the stories. In fact, he was more of a hinderance than a help for the Fellowship. As is such often with things though, he did in fact play a big part in the final conquering of evil, but it was completely unintentional and driven off of his own greed.
